Senior Engineer - Java (Exchange Platform - Social Trading)
About Us:
At OKX, we believe that technology is reshaping our future. Since our establishment in 2017, OKX has emerged as a leading global cryptocurrency exchange, offering a wide range of products, solutions, and trading tools. We have leveraged blockchain technology to transform the financial ecosystem and provide an engaging platform for over 20 million users in 180 regions worldwide. Committed to innovation, we also offer OKX Insights, a research arm that stays at the forefront of the cryptocurrency industry. Our vision is to create a world of financial access powered by blockchain and decentralized finance.
We value our people as much as we value technology. Our culture fosters teamwork, embraces change, and promotes ethical behavior. We strive to create a friendly, inclusive, and rewarding environment where everyone feels valued, respected, and has equal opportunities to grow and succeed. No matter where you come from, we want to bring out the best in you.
Responsibilities:
- Design and implement innovative solutions for our leading social trading platform
- Optimize system performance to ensure low latency, high availability, and scalability
- Mentor engineers within the team to deliver high-quality work
Qualifications:
- Strong background in STEM (Science/Technology/Engineering/Mathematics)
- Excellent logical thinking and problem-solving skills
- Proficient in high-performance Java and asynchronous programming patterns
- Familiarity with distributed systems and microservice architecture
- Experience with automated testing and continuous integration
- Team player with the ability to independently solve problems
- Responsible and self-driven mindset
- Fluent in English
Perks & Benefits:
- Competitive total compensation
- Comprehensive insurance coverage for employees and dependents
- More perks to be discussed during the hiring process!
